Abstract

Magnetic and electric properties of the pseudoternary system UNi 1−xCo xGa 5 were investigated by means of specific heat, magnetic susceptibility and electric resistivity measurements. The antiferromagnetic ordering temperature, T N , which corresponds to 85.5 K for x = 0, is depressed with increasing x and becomes zero near x ⋍ 0.37 . The low-temperature electronic specific heat coefficient, γ, and magnetic susceptibility extrapolated to 0 K, χ(0), are obtained as a function of x. The results are discussed in terms of f-spd hybridization.
